    For what it is worth, my Acer running Windows 10 with Nvidia 630M just started doing this too. And I know it started immediately after I updated the driver for Nvidia; I was watching a video file before the update, opened the same file after updating and the computer was doing the one second freeze every minute.

    A quick search on google found the new update for Nvidia (364.72 in my case) has caused quite a few problems and there does not seem to be a good way to roll back.

    Another addition, I have noticed with my laptop that if I unplug it, the problem stops. Running on battery there is NO hang/freeze every minute. As soon as I plug it back in, it starts to hang/freeze every minute.

  8. 1 second image freeze exactly every minute

    I figured out why it was doing it now. It has to do with the background for me, I had it set to slideshow that changed every minute. While it is on battery slideshow is deactivated, so I turned off slideshow and set the background to a static image all the time (on battery and off) and the issue was fixed.

    I'm just wondering if there's a way of real-time monitoring the GPU..
    try this:
    GPU-Z Video card GPU Information Utility
    Click the sensors tab and you'll get the monitor display.
    You'd obviously be looking for a periodic (1min) load indication.
